Version 22.5
List of updates and fixes
- RELEASE Release of iOS client 18.1
- RELEASE Release of Desktop client 20.4
Enhancements
- Added a status parameter to the API for event session search to filter by status collection
- Added support for exceptions to the "Remote Desktop Management" feature, including automatic disabling of remote management capabilities and sending corresponding events when system settings/participant rights are changed
Fixes
- Restored display of metrics related to replication when working with a database in an Active/Active/DB StandBy cluster
- Fixed an error in creating a database backup when using an external database - this process is now ignored, as backup of an external database should be done using external tools
- Fixed incorrect parameter setting when editing redirection - error in saving address and profile ID after editing the profile for a previously created redirection

Desktop client 20.4
Enhancements
- Added support for Logi C505e-HD cameras
- Added exception handling when sending files with an updated error list from the server
- Added the ability to flip through document pages using hotkeys (arrows) during screen sharing
- Implemented support for joining an event 30/60 minutes in advance - added the ability when creating/editing an event to set and change values for connecting to the event before its start: 30 and 60 minutes
- Improved display of reactions in the event - changed the event interface to correctly display reactions and notifications when interacting with content
- Implemented full page-by-page loading of event participants on the event information/editing page
Fixes
